NIA Court Sentences 10 Maoists for 2013 Jhiram Ghati Massacre in Chhattisgarh

The National Investigation Agency (NIA) court in Raipur convicted ten alleged Maoist cadres for their involvement in the 2013 Jhiram Ghati massacre in Chhattisgarh.

The NIA special court in Raipur delivered its judgment on the long‑pending case relating to the Jhiram Ghati massacre that occurred in 2013 in the state of Chhattisgarh. Ten individuals alleged to be members of the Maoist insurgency were found guilty of participation in the attack that resulted in multiple civilian deaths.

The conviction marks a significant milestone in the central government's effort to bring accountability for extremist violence in the region. While the court did not disclose the exact sentences at the time of the ruling, the convicted persons are expected to face stringent penalties under the provisions of the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act.

Legal experts noted that the verdict underscores the effectiveness of the NIA’s investigative framework, which has been handling several high‑profile cases of left‑wing extremism across the country. The ruling also reaffirms the judiciary’s resolve to address crimes that have historically remained unresolved in the mineral‑rich but conflict‑prone districts of Chhattisgarh.

Families of the victims, who have been awaiting justice for more than a decade, welcomed the decision, describing it as a step towards closure. The state government has pledged to provide necessary support to the affected families and to ensure that the convicted individuals are prosecuted without delay.
